Accuracy and Precision

Lidar is an important technology that allows robots to navigate in a home. It allows them to avoid collisions and other obstacles. The system makes use of laser sensors to send out a pulse and then determine the time taken to bounce the pulse back from an obstacle to determine its distance. This creates a 3D representation of the room. This allows the robot to trace an obstacle-free path and efficiently cover a room without omitting any aspect of the room.

This method is more efficient than navigation systems such as ultrasonic or infrared sensors which rely on sound waves. The sensor can detect solid objects, or even dust specks on a floor. It also has a high level of accuracy, which makes it less likely to hit furniture or other objects in the home.

A lidar also works in dark and bright environments which allows the robot to operate in different lighting levels. The sensors also allow the robot to detect changes in the surroundings, such as the movement of furniture or introducing a new item. The robot makes use of this information to modify its movements to ensure that the cleaning process runs more smoothly.

A robot with lidar technology can detect edge detection, which is a feature that helps keep from falling down stairs, or other differences between levels. This can reduce the risk of damage being done to the vacuum cleaner or your home. It can also make the robot safer for children and pets who may run into it.

Other navigation systems, such as gyroscopes or cameras can also be useful in the context of robot vacuum cleaners. However, they aren't as accurate in comparison to the laser-based sensor found in a lidar robot vacuum. They also require more setup and calibration in order to work effectively.

This is why a lot of customers choose to invest in an automated vacuum cleaner that is equipped with lidar navigation. The price of a device that uses this technology is slightly more than other navigation devices, but the benefits are substantial.

Reduced Collision Risks

Think about a vacuum cleaner that features lidar navigation if your goal is a more furniture-friendly model. This technology minimizes the risk of collisions and protects your furniture from being scratched. It also makes it easier for the robot to maneuver through cluttered areas without crashing into furniture or other obstacles.

Lidar technology makes use of lasers to scan the surrounding area and sense reflections of the beam on objects to create a 3D model of the room. This allows the robot to determine where obstacles are located and maneuver around them with precision. The sensors are less likely to be confused by shadows or different colors than cameras, which make them a good choice for use in rooms with changing lighting conditions.

However, there are certain limitations when using this kind of sensor for navigation by robotics. For instance, it may be difficult for the system to recognize reflective or transparent surfaces, like glass coffee tables or mirrors. The laser signals that are generated by this system could traverse these surfaces and then be reflected back at an angle not detected by the sensor. This could cause the robot to mistakenly interpret these surfaces as being free of obstacles, causing damage to furniture as well as the vacuum.

Other navigation systems like gyroscopes are often more effective in avoidance of collisions than camera-based technology. They are also less expensive than systems that rely on lasers to create maps of the environment. They aren't as precise or efficient at navigating as laser-based systems like lidar and SLAM.

In addition to decreasing the number of collisions as well as reducing the amount of collisions lidar-equipped robots will help them clean more thoroughly. They can avoid bumping into furniture and obstacles by creating maps. They can also plan their routes in advance, tracing backwards and forwards along the Y shape.

If you're willing to accept the possibility of your furniture being damaged You can save money by choosing the cheapest robot that comes with sensors to avoid obstacles, such as ultrasonic or infrared. But if scuffed furniture or scratches on your walls aren't acceptable you should look for a model equipped with laser navigation.
